The training session focused on Stone Island Spring/Summer 2025 campaign, with a particular emphasis on:
The brand’s revolutionary fabric technologies, including its latest innovation: UV-reactive knitwear. This remarkable material changes colour when exposed to direct sunlight - an innovation also applied to outerwear, creating truly standout pieces.
